Tetra Pak is using groundbreaking new digital technologies to deliver even more value to our customers. A Digital Transformation Program has been established to ensure that we maintain and extend our industry leadership by driving digital business development, developing digital products and services, and building internal capabilities. Digital Program organization´s mission is to coordinate and accelerate Tetra Pak's Digital Transformation programme. Our objective is to provide company-wide coordination and communication of digital transformation activities, to deliver critical digital capabilities from a central hub and to support agile resource prioritisation and effective decision making.

In your role as Analyst Data Scientist, you will belong to the Digital Transformation Office and be part of Tetra Pak´s Data Science CoE. You will participate in various projects, influence business decisions and drive digital transformation at one of the largest consumer packaging companies in the world. This position will be placed in Lund, Sweden.

We are now looking for Analyst Data Scientists with strength in at least one of these three different profiles:
Coding: Knowledge of ETL development is a must. Experience with distributed databases and query languages such as SQL, Python, Scala, U-SQL and/or general map reduce computing is a plus. Knowledge of common data structures and ability to write efficient code in at least one language is a plus.
-Statistical coding R, Python, SAS, MATLAB. Skilled as a user of big data architectures like Spark-Hadoop, ADLS/ADLA, Cloudera together with machine learning platforms like Tensor flow or Café.
-Education: Computer Science

Statistics & Math's: Knowledge of quantitative methods is important. From statistical inference to predictive and prescriptive modeling together with optimization skills. You have a strong algorithmic thinking and independent research ability.
-Analyze data with statistical rigor. Ensure accurate interpretation by combining business acumen with detailed data knowledge and statistical expertise.
-Build statistical models to uncover insights or effect changes
-Education: Statistics, Mathematics

Functional: Good understanding of operational processes, KPI's and decision supporting systems. Mainly in areas like production, quality (lean six sigma), maintenance (reliability centered maintenance), logistics (SCM) and after sales process (warranty). Complementary revenue management for pricing and marketing (customer insights).
-Translate analytic insights into concrete, actionable recommendations for business or product improvement, and communicate these findings.
-Drive efforts to enable independent interpretation of results through education, improved tools, and data visualization.
-Education: Engineering/Operations Research/Math's/Econometric analysis/Physics or Statistics. Master or Phd in Data Science.
-Minimum experience of 2 years within Data Science projects.

Responsibilities

Main Responsibilities:

-Participate in data science projects, be hands-on with code building data marts for model development, statistical model development, test, implement and deployment of data science solutions to solve various business issues.
-Work on research replicability and industrialization. Model deployment. Code standards.
-Collaborate in the development of visual consumption layer of the models (decision support systems)
-Work closely with Data Scientist Consultants/Managers, Business stakeholders and subject matter experts to review expected outputs and applicability to business challenge
-Identify and take part in operationalization of valuable insights from the data into business and digital applications.

Soft skills:
As a person, you are a team player, honest and humble. You have exceptional interpersonal and communication skills coupled with strong business acumen. You must be able to translate business objectives into actionable analyses, and analytical results into actionable business and product recommendations. You have a passion for learning and innovating new methodologies at the intersection of statistics, applied math and computer science. Furthermore, you are a high-energy self-starter with passion for your work, put attention to details and have a positive attitude. Excellent written and verbal English skills are essential.
